Apple ID for family Sharing

Hello I am setting up my kids apple watches. I am doing it under family sharing plan. Can i use my apple ID for both of there watches? Or do I need to create a new apple ID for both kid watches? (keep in my i am going to heavily monitor everything)

If you are going to set up Family Sharing, each family member should have their own Apple ID.
